Top 50 Minnesota Foundations by Assets, 2004
Minnesota's largest foundations and corporate grantmakers ranked by 2004 asset size

2004
Rank

Foundation/Corporate Grantmaker

Assets

FY End

2003 Rank

1  

The McKnight Foundation $2,016,000,000 12/31/04 1  

2  

Bush Foundation $732,455,635 11/30/04 3  

3  

The Saint Paul Foundation (1) $732,288,544 12/31/04 2  

4  

Fred C. and Katherine B. Andersen Foundation $662,906,121 12/31/04 5  

5  

The Minneapolis Foundation (2) $597,646,545 3/31/05 4  

6  

Otto Bremer Foundation $495,972,124 12/31/04 6  

7  

Northwest Area Foundation $452,533,605 3/31/05 7  

8  

Blandin Foundation $413,253,276 12/31/04 8  

9  

Charles K. Blandin Residuary Trust $355,943,736 12/31/04 9  

10  

The Hormel Foundation $217,904,000 11/30/04 11  

11  

The Jay and Rose Phillips Family Foundation $196,907,580 12/31/04 12  

12  

Minnesota Partnership for Action Against Tobacco $166,400,100 6/30/04 10  

13  

F.R. Bigelow Foundation $145,815,420 12/31/04 13  

14  

J. A. Wedum Foundation $142,783,515 12/31/04 —  

15  

Catholic Community Foundation in the Archdiocese of Saint Paul and Minneapolis $138,199,512 6/30/04 14  

16  

Lutheran Community Foundation $127,766,322 12/31/04 15  

17  

Wem Foundation $122,452,399 12/31/04 19  

18  

Alliss Educational Foundation $103,496,505 12/31/04 16  

19  

I. A. O'Shaughnessy Foundation, Incorporated $93,443,876 12/31/04 18  

20  

Thrivent Financial for Lutherans Foundation and Corporation $80,000,000 12/31/04 17  

21  

Hugh J. Andersen Foundation $77,751,037 2/28/05 23  

22  

The Jerome Foundation $76,545,212 4/30/05 20  

23  

Cargill Foundation & Corporation $70,057,082 12/31/04 21  

24  

Curtis L. Carlson Family Foundation (3) $67,150,544 12/31/03 25  

25  

Andreas Foundation $61,845,854 11/30/04 29  

26  

Patrick & Aimee Butler Family Foundation $60,399,814 12/31/04 24  

27  

U.S. Bancorp Foundation $58,590,668 12/31/04 22  

28  

Mardag Foundation $54,168,203 12/31/04 26  

29  

Blue Cross and Blue Shield of Minnesota Foundation & Corporation $52,048,310 12/31/04 27  

30  

General Mills Community Action & Corporation $49,425,518 5/31/05 31  

31  

The Wasie Foundation $49,283,125 12/31/04 28  

32  

The Bayport Foundation of Andersen Corporation $45,948,670 11/30/04 30  

33  

Northland Foundation $45,701,473 6/30/04 —  

34  

Central Minnesota Community Foundation $42,451,244 6/30/04 36  

35  

Ted and Roberta Mann Foundation $42,000,000 12/31/04 —  

36  

The Sabes Family Foundation $41,476,508 12/31/04 —  

37  

George Family Foundation $39,770,736 12/31/04 —  

38  

Ida C. Koran Trust $39,764,035 12/31/04 35  

39  

Edelstein Family Foundation $39,753,748 12/31/04 —  

40  

Southwest Minnesota Foundation $39,119,770 6/30/04 37  

41  

Ordean Foundation $38,971,415 12/31/04 32  

42  

Fargo-Moorhead Area Foundation $38,830,447 12/31/04 —  

43  

3M Foundation & Corporation $38,724,763 12/31/04 34  

44  

Duluth-Superior Area Community Foundation $37,984,757 12/31/04 39  

45  

West Central Initiative $37,357,302 6/30/04 40  

46  

Initiative Foundation $36,309,311 6/30/04 —  

47  

Carolyn Foundation $36,262,379 12/31/04 38  

48  

Northwest Minnesota Foundation $35,200,000 6/30/04 —  

49  

Kopp Family Foundation $34,649,166 12/31/04 33  

50  

Securian Financial Group & Foundation $34,139,000 12/31/04 —  
(1) The Saint Paul Foundation includes the Minnesota Community Foundation, J. Paper Foundation and A.F. Paper Foundation.
(2) The Minneapolis Foundation includes Emma B. Howe Foundation, Robins, Kaplan, Miller and Ciresi LLP Foundation for Education, Public Health and Social Justice, and Nonprofits Assistance Fund (Formerly Community Loan Technologies).
(3) The Curtis L. Carlson Family Foundation's grants paid and asset figures are for 2003.
